Why Investors Shouldn't Be Surprised By Xuancheng Valin Precision Technology Co., Ltd.'s (SHSE:603356) 31% Share Price Plunge

Simply Wall St ·  Apr 17 08:02

The Xuancheng Valin Precision Technology Co., Ltd. (SHSE:603356) share price has fared very poorly over the last month, falling by a substantial 31%. The drop over the last 30 days has capped off a tough year for shareholders, with the share price down 23% in that time.

Since its price has dipped substantially, Xuancheng Valin Precision Technology may be sending bullish signals at the moment with its price-to-sales (or "P/S") ratio of 0.9x, since almost half of all companies in the Machinery industry in China have P/S ratios greater than 2.6x and even P/S higher than 5x are not unusual. Nonetheless, we'd need to dig a little deeper to determine if there is a rational basis for the reduced P/S.

Is There Any Revenue Growth Forecasted For Xuancheng Valin Precision Technology?

The only time you'd be truly comfortable seeing a P/S as low as Xuancheng Valin Precision Technology's is when the company's growth is on track to lag the industry.

In reviewing the last year of financials, we were disheartened to see the company's revenues fell to the tune of 17%. This means it has also seen a slide in revenue over the longer-term as revenue is down 13% in total over the last three years. Accordingly, shareholders would have felt downbeat about the medium-term rates of revenue growth.

Weighing that medium-term revenue trajectory against the broader industry's one-year forecast for expansion of 24% shows it's an unpleasant look.

With this information, we are not surprised that Xuancheng Valin Precision Technology is trading at a P/S lower than the industry. Nonetheless, there's no guarantee the P/S has reached a floor yet with revenue going in reverse. There's potential for the P/S to fall to even lower levels if the company doesn't improve its top-line growth.
